For a replacement hose clamp, drop on down to NAPA and ask for their
Breeze CT clamps. You
need the CT350 clamps for the big end but you can probably get the
CT300 on the small end to
save a buck. Sorry, I don't have the NAPA part # handy, but you can
take it from here.
Then throw away that T-bolt junk. Make sure to inspect the hose bib
to make sure you didn't
damage it by tightening the T-bolt too much.

> Climbing onto the boost this morning the car went "BANG!!!" and power
> disappeared. Yup, blew off a hose. :-(
>
> I spent the next half hour jacking up the front of the urS6 so I
> could get under it at the side of the road (well, actually I managed
> to limp into a bank parking lot) and pulling the belly pan.
>
> Yup - sure enough, the turbo ---> crossover hose was off the
> crossover pipe. Simple repair except for one small problem - there
> was no way to loosen the clamp so I could put it back on over the
> Samco hose/crossover junction. I did, however, manage to screw up
> the old T clamp enough to make it unusable even if I could have
> opened it up. I need a replacement T clamp.
>
> IIRC, I got the one I just screwed up from ECSTuning but I don't find
> a suitable replacement part in their on-line catalog.
>
> So - where do I find a good replacement hose clamp these days?
